Clarendelle red seeks its inspiration in the quality, elegance and harmony of the Domaine Clarence Dillon family
of wines. The wine seeks not power but rather balance. This philosophy aims to reflect the excellence and tradition of its heritage. The character and subtle structure of Clarendelle red comes from the "assemblage", a rigorous selection of Bordeaux's three traditional red grapes varietals. The art of assemblage consist of blending the quality and characteristics of each grape varietal in order to make up a harmonious wine, thereby determinating the style of the future Clarendelle red. The proportion of each grape will vary according to the vintage.
The Merlot is first to ripen and enjoys a natural softness. It provides the wine with a beautiful deep purple colour. "This mantle" cloaks a soft velvety roundness which one could say provides the body of this assemblage.

The Cabernet Sauvignon, later-ripening varietals, provides both the freshness and armature for the wine thereby bringing with it refinement and structure but also a greater potential for aging.

The Cabernet Franc offers a deep colour and subtle floral aromas, an extra elegance or even a soul to our wine.
